The Rheinische Fachhochschule Cologne provides the bachelor’s degree “Bachelor of Science in Psychology”. It takes the form of a six-semester full-time, and seven-semester part-time program, and accumulates 180 credit points for its holders. Apart from having an extremely intriguing subject matter, study of psychology is becoming more and more employed in all spheres of economy, personal and social life. The scope of jobs to be done through obtaining a degree in the matter is increasing on a daily basis. The degree intends to answer practical application questions and needs of the specialists, so a methodology of statistical, scientific, empirical, evidence-based diagnostics, research and test-development will be provided throughout the course. The point of the studies is to objectivize to the maximum observations, whose interpretation is greatly individually subjectivised. Further specialization can be pursued in company, clinical, personnel, media, market psychology and psychotherapy.
